all repos — openbox @ 9be1d64d366ba57c1fc986d3d2aee90654a268a8

openbox fork - make it a bit more like ryudo

dont change desktop when its out of range
Dana Jansens danakj@orodu.net
commit

9be1d64d366ba57c1fc986d3d2aee90654a268a8

parent

bcdef0b226bb436c5ba5865c3d8dd2eb4bb6aed6

1 files changed, 3 insertions(+), 1 deletions(-)

jump to
M openbox/event.copenbox/event.c

@@ -485,7 +485,9 @@ break;

} e->xclient = ce.xclient; } - client_set_desktop(client, e->xclient.data.l[0]); + if (e->xclient.data.l[0] >= 0 && + e->xclient.data.l[0] < screen_num_desktops) + client_set_desktop(client, e->xclient.data.l[0]); } else if (msgtype == prop_atoms.net_wm_state) { /* can't compress these */ g_message("net_wm_state %s %ld %ld for 0x%lx",